i just moved to new orleans this month, and was hired at rick's saloon last week. it has been painfully slow most nights. i worked last night to scope out the weekday scene, and there were literally 5 (very cheap) customers in the 5 hours i was there. it seems only a few dancers there are making any money at all, and even then not consistently. spoke with a dancer who had been there for several years who told me she had left with less than $100 most nights in december.

i have a couple friends working at barely legal who seem to make more money in general, but it's hit or miss. everyone i've spoken to who has been dancing here for a while has complained that this is the slowest they've seen business on bourbon, like ever. bosses at rick's saloon keep assuring me that business will pick up as mardi gras approaches, but i am skeptical.

for those of you wondering about the hiring freeze, from what i hear it seems to have been lifted at most clubs now.

i work at rick's saloon and sometimes at babes. it has been dead af at rick's post-mardi gras. i've gotten lucky with a couple good customers, but a lot of nights lately people are walking out with $100 or less, myself included. MG was total shit. everyone i talked to who had worked previous mardi gras' said it was the worst they'd ever seen. so many dancers! so few customers. now that MG is over there are significantly less dancers working on bourbon, so it might be a good time to get in a club now if you plan to stay through the upcoming conventions and jazz fest. if you are traveling for short-term work though, beware! it probably won't be worth it.

I just got back from my trip to Nola. I was there from February 11 - 20 with another dancer.

The first night we worked was valentine's day and it was busy and the real estate convention was still going on. There wasn't a lot of girls. I sold 2 hours of champagne room to a drunk realtor and I made $1500 for the night after working about 12 hours.

The second night I worked was last night, and all the conventions were out of town and it was dead. I only worked 6 hours and only made $150. Literally 1/10 from the other night I worked. I worked 2 more nights--one night I only made $300 and the next one I only made $500. I can expect to make $300-500 at my club back home without really trying so I'm thankful I got lucky that one night but I don't think I'll be coming back to Nola for work.

So far it seems like definitely check the convention schedule if you plan on going to nola. A girl named Maria (not sure if that's real name or stage name) that I met at Hustler in Baltimore was in town, we just ran in to her on bourbon st. She said she was working at penthouse and really liked it. I was thinking about auditioning there instead of working at hustler but it seems like there's more competition over there.

Good to know that jazz fest is financially insignificant because my friend and I were thinking about going down.

The first night we were there we checked out almost all of the clubs. Hustler and Penthouse were the busiest. The rooms are more expensive at Hustler but can be harder to sell. Penthouse definitely had more competition than Hustler though. Babes was busy but you definitely have to know how to work a pole to be successful there--we didn't see a single girl that couldn't climb the pole and do tricks on it, and they made a lot of money on stage. You didn't see any of them hustling for dances. Scores had nice decor and all the girls were attractive but it was really small. Couldn't really tell if the girls were making any money or not.

For a hotel, I recommend staying at Aloft--it's part of the W hotels and is super nice. 2 blocks from Bourbon St on the other side of Canal St in a super safe area. Close enough for the bouncers to walk you home.
